China News Agency, Paris, March 23 (Reporter Li Yang) On the 23rd local time, the cumulative number of confirmed cases of new coronary pneumonia in France reached 4.31 million.

The current incidence of new crowns in the Paris region is soaring, and the number of severely ill patients continues to rise.

  According to the epidemic data released by the French Ministry of Health that night, there were 14,678 newly confirmed cases in France on the 23rd, and the total number of confirmed cases was 4313073.

According to Worldometer's real-time statistics, the cumulative number of confirmed cases in France has now surpassed the United Kingdom, ranking fifth in the world.

The cumulative number of deaths in France is now 92,908, with 287 new deaths.

The number of inpatients with the new crown in France increased to 26,756, and the number of critically ill patients increased to 4,634.

  The epidemic situation in the Paris Region continues to worsen.

According to the latest data released by the Paris Region Health Bureau, the incidence of new crowns in the region has increased to 551 new crowns per 100,000 inhabitants, greatly exceeding the official warning threshold; the number of severely ill patients with new crowns in the region has increased to 1,370.

  The Paris Region Health Bureau also revealed that the incidence of new crowns in the region between 20 and 50 years old has increased sharply to 700 new crown infections per 100,000 inhabitants; Paris Region Seine-Saint-Denis Department is 20 to 50 years old The population’s incidence of new crowns has increased to 800 for every 100,000 residents.

At the same time, an increasing number of relatively young critically ill patients are admitted to the intensive care unit.

  The Paris Region Health Bureau assessed that the number of critically ill patients in the region is likely to exceed 1,500 in the next few days. Therefore, it is necessary to continue to increase the number of intensive care beds and continue to cancel the planned surgical arrangements to increase the number of intensive care beds to 2,200 The goal.

  French health experts warned that if the spread of the virus cannot be slowed down in the short term, the medical system will face "unprecedented pressure" in the next three weeks.

French President Macron said on the 23rd that France will open new crown vaccination for people over 70 years old from this weekend, nearly a month earlier than originally planned.

Macron requested that the vaccination schedule should continue to be accelerated.
